Benefits of EMR for the patient- no more risk of lost paper records:
- Health Connect eliminates the need for patients to collect and deliver various medical records and images to the different specialties involved in their clinical care.
- clinicians are able to see any x-ray results and the actual images that they can review with you in their office, that were obtained anywhere within Kaiser Permanente Northern California
- clinicians are able to see medical encounters that were obtained anywhere within Kaiser Permanente Northern California, in order to facilitate better communication for your optimal care.
- all laboratory, x-ray, and referrals can be ordered online by the clinician- no more lost paper requests
- all laboratory and x-ray results are sent directly to the clinician online- no more lost paper results

Obtain your own Electronic portable medical record before traveling abroad:
You may request a flash drive from the Patient Records department, and it usually takes only a few minutes to program and obtain the drive. A small fee is charged for this service. The drive contains the following information:
- Patient demographics, including age, gender and ethnicity
- Language preferences
- Contact information for family and friends
- Primary care physician(s) info
- Active medical problem lists
- Allergies
- Immunization records
- Lab results from the past year
- Medications prescribed or refilled in the past year
- Clinic visit information with diagnoses and procedures in the past year
- Hospitalizations with diagnoses and procedures
- Most recent EKGs and chest X-rays — both readings and images.
